I just purchased a 2007 Metallic Gray XLE and was wondering if anyone has attempted to add a backup camera to the NAV system? I know that the 2007 Lexus ES350 has the same NAV system and offers a backup camera. Any thoughts?
It is the only option other than ventilated seats that I really wanted on the Camry, but I could not justify the extra $10,000 for the Lexus to get those two items!

you can order the camera from the lexus dealer they are compatible with your system the only thing is you may have to drill a hole to locate the camera in you rear bumper or somewhere facing rear.
I want to do the same thing. I noticed that the Prius has a backup camera mounted above the rear license plate on the facia where the plate lamps are. I am hoping that if I purchase the camera (not sure if I can get the wiring) that I'll be able to connect it to the DVD Nav.

The function of the reverse camera is so you know how close you are to objects behind your car, not to replace looking back. It does not give nearly as wide of a view as actually looking does.
Let's say a kid on a bike is going down the sidewalk. You can see them without a problem. If you rely on the reverse camera, you can't see them until they are actually behind your car.
